powerless

English

Etymology

From Middle English pouerles, powerles, equivalent to power +? -less.

Adjective

powerless (comparative more powerless, superlative most powerless)

  1. Lacking sufficient power or strength.

  2. Lacking legal authority.
    The traffic warden was powerless to stop me driving away.

Synonyms

  • mightless
  • strengthless
  • weak
  • vulnerable

Antonyms

  • powerful
  • strong

Derived terms

  • powerlessly
  • powerlessness
  • superpowerless

noneffective

English

Etymology

non- +? effective

Adjective

noneffective (not comparable)

  1. Not effective.
    The game strategy he pursued was noneffective, and he was beaten soundly.
  2. (military) Not able to assume active duty.
    After his injury, he was declared noneffective and given a medical discharge.

Synonyms

  • (not effective): impotent, ineffective, lacking, powerless

Noun

noneffective (plural noneffectives)

  1. A member of the military who is unable to assume active duty.
